Extracting of Copper from Other Ores. Copper can be extracted from nonsulfide ores by a different process involving three separate stages: Reaction of the ore (over quite a long time and on a huge scale) with a dilute acid such as dilute sulfuric acid to produce a very dilute copper(II) sulfate solution.

Extraction and refining. The extraction of copper from ore is normally carried out in three major steps. The first step, mineral processing, is to liberate the copper minerals and remove waste constituents—such as alumina, limestone, pyrite, and silica—so that the copper minerals and other nonferrous minerals of value are concentrated into a product containing between 20 and 30 percent copper.

EXTRACTION OF COPPER FROM SULPHIDE ORE Large amount of copper are obtained from copper pyrite (CuFeS2) by smelting. Ores containing 4% or more copper are treated by smelting process. Very poor ores are treated by hydrometallurgical process. EXTRACTION OF COPPER BY SMELTING PROCESS Following steps are involved in the extraction of copper.

Most of the copper ores mined today are oxide or sulfide ores. Extraction of sulfide ores is covered in more detail in Copper Mining and Extraction: Sulfide Ores (11–14), but is introduced here because an important byproduct of this process is used for the extraction of oxide ores. Heap leaching is an industrial mining process used to extract precious metals, copper, uranium, and other compounds from ore using a series of chemical reactions that absorb specific minerals and reseparate them after their division from other earth materials. Similar to in situ mining, heap leach mining differs in that it places ore on a liner, then adds the chemicals via drip systems to the ...
